Average temperature and rainfall in Lingayen by month
Averages of the daily highs and lows recorded in each month, with total rainfall, mean humidity and mean wind speed.
| Month | Avg high | Avg low | Record low / high | Rainfall | Humidity | Wind |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 29°C | 20°C | 12°C / 35°C | 25 mm | 75% | 7 km/h |
| February | 31°C | 20°C | 12°C / 38°C | 31 mm | 71% | 8 km/h |
| March | 33°C | 21°C | 15°C / 40°C | 82 mm | 70% | 8 km/h |
| April | 34°C | 23°C | 17°C / 41°C | 125 mm | 71% | 8 km/h |
| May | 34°C | 24°C | 19°C / 41°C | 111 mm | 74% | 8 km/h |
| June | 32°C | 24°C | 19°C / 40°C | 139 mm | 83% | 7 km/h |
| July | 30°C | 23°C | 17°C / 36°C | 278 mm | 87% | 8 km/h |
| August | 29°C | 23°C | 19°C / 35°C | 304 mm | 89% | 8 km/h |
| September | 29°C | 23°C | 19°C / 33°C | 176 mm | 89% | 7 km/h |
| October | 29°C | 22°C | 17°C / 33°C | 142 mm | 86% | 7 km/h |
| November | 30°C | 22°C | 16°C / 34°C | 52 mm | 81% | 7 km/h |
| December | 30°C | 22°C | 16°C / 35°C | 39 mm | 77% | 7 km/h |
Best time to visit Lingayen
The most comfortable time to visit Lingayen is generally December to February, balancing mild daytime temperatures against the driest stretch of the year. Temperatures stay fairly even all year and rain concentrates around August, totalling about 1504 mm a year.
Travellers who prefer heat should aim for May, when highs average 34°C. August is the month to avoid if rain would spoil your plans — it averages 304 mm, roughly 12× the rainfall of January.
